2.Gravitational erythema:a case report
Jianbo WANG ; Xueli LI ; Zhenlu LI
Chinese Journal of Dermatology 2015;(9):640-641
A 15-year-old female patient presented with orthostatic erythema in the limbs for half a year. Skin examination revealed that diffuse reticular erythema appeared in the limbs after standing with her arms hanging down for 30 seconds, while the erythema disappeared and skin color returned to normal after raising her arms or lying flat for 30 seconds. The rash in the limbs was reproduced by inflating a sphygmomanometer cuff to 60 mmHg for 2 minutes with the limbs in the horizontal position. Antinuclear antibodies were positive at a titer of 1 ∶1 000. Histopathological examination showed dilated small vessels in the superficial dermis without obvious inflammatory cell infiltration. The patient was diagnosed with gravitational erythema.
3.Effects and related mechanisms of preconditioning with puerarin on hippocampus CA1 region neuronal injury after focal cerebral ischemia-reperfusion
Acta Universitatis Medicinalis Anhui 2015;(6):723-726
Objective To observe the effect of puerarin preconditioning on hippocampal CA1 region neuronal injury and further explore its mechanisms. Methods 30 male Sprague-Dawley rats were randomly assigned into sham, model,and puerarin preconditioning ischemia-reperfusion groups. The middle cerebral artery was occluded for 60 min by an intraluminal filament before reperfusion to induce transient focal cerebral ischemia reperfusion rats. Puer-arin preconditioning groups rats received puerarin(100 mg / kg,i. p)1 h before ischemia. The histological changes of hippocampal CA1 region neurons were measured by HE staining on the 5th day after reperfusion. The expressions of Caspase-3 and Caspase-9 proteins in the CA1 region were examined by immunohistochemistry staining. Results The results of HE staining showed that,compared with the model group,puerarin preconditioning significantly re-duced the number of cerebral ischemia induced injury of hippocampal CA1 region neurons(P < 0. 05). Immunohis-tochemistry data showed that the expressions of Caspase-3 and Caspase-9 in the hippocampal CA1 region of puerarin preconditioning group were significantly lower than that of model group(P < 0. 05). Conclusion The results indi-cate that puerarin preconditioning 1 h before ischemia exerts neuroprotective effects on focal cerebral ischemia-reperfusion induced neuronal injury. The neuroprotective mechanisms of puerarin may attribute to inhibiting the ex-pressions of Caspase-3 and Caspase-9 protein.
4.Effect of patient's preoperative visit to operating room on the preoperative apprehension
Shaofang LI ; Xueli ZHAO ; Wenping JIA
Chinese Journal of Anesthesiology 2010;30(4):416-417
Objective To evaluate the effect of the patient's preoperative visit to the operating room on the patient's apprehension before operation.Methods One hundred and Sixty patients aged 16-64 yr with fear visual analog scale (FVAS) score≥4 scheduled for elective surgery were randomly divided into 2 groups(n=80 each):control group and study group.In control group the anesthesiologists visited their patients the day before operation ns usual;while in study group the anesthesiologists brought their patients to the operating room,showed them the environment and anesthesia equipment and assured of the safety of the operation and anesthesia.The degree of fear was scored according to FVAS (O=no fear,1-3 mild,4-6 moderate,7-10 severe) and was evaluated on the 1st morning after admission(T1),the night before operation(T2)and before induction of anesthesia(T3).MAP and HR at T1-3 and blood glucose level at T1,3 were mensured and recorded.Results The patient's preoperative apprehension was significantly allayed by patient's preoperative visit to the operating room.The MAP,HR,incidence of moderate and severe fear at T2,3 and blood glucose level at T3 were significantly lower in study group than in control group.Conclusion Patient's preoperative visit to the operating room can allay precperative apprehension.
5.Studies on the risk factors associated with macula choroidal neovascularization in high myopia
Xuexi LI ; Qiaoya LIN ; Xueli HUANG
Medical Journal of Chinese People's Liberation Army 2001;0(09):-
Objective To investigate the prevalence of macula choroidal neovascularization(CNV) in high myopia patients and the associated risk factors.Methods Fifty-six outpatients(112 eyes) with high myopia were medically examined from Mar.2008 to Jun.2009.The inspection items,including A scan,B scan,diopter and optical coherence tomography(OCT),were carried out to check whether CNV existed and its growth fashion.The patients' basic status,main symptoms and the pathologic change in macula were recorded.Results The prevalence of CNV in the 56 outpatients(112 eyes) was 14.3%.Gender showed no correlation with CNV(r=-0.015,P=0.879),while age(r=0.629,P=0.000),diopter(r=0.725,P=0.000),axial length(r=0.236,P=0.013),posterior scleral staphyloma(r=0.344,P=0.000),atrophy of choroid and retina in posterior pole(r=0.421,P=0.000),lacquer crack(r=0.421,P=0.000) and Fuchs spot(r=0.519,P=0.000) were significantly correlated with the prevalence of CNV.Conclusions CNV may highly occurred in the patients with high myopia.Posterior scleral staphyloma,atrophy of choroid and retina in posterior pole,lacquer crack,Fuchs spot,age,axial length and diopter seem to be the risk factors for the occurence of CNV.
6.Microstructure and modification of Nd and Zn trace elements in a Mg-Zn-Y-Nd vascular alloy stent
Xueli LU ; Xinliang YAO ; Yanming LI
Chinese Journal of Tissue Engineering Research 2017;21(10):1571-1576
BACKGROUND: With the continuous development of materials science, magnesium alloy vascular stent materials have become a hot research. Because of the mechanical properties and biocompatibility of commercial magnesium alloy, it is difficult to meet the requirements of vascular stents. Therefore, effective measures to improve the sten's surface properties and comprehensive performance become the focus of research.OBJECTIVE: To study the histology and surface modification of vascular stents in rapidly solidified Mg-Zn-Y-Nd alloy.Methods: The low-zinc Mg-2Zn-0.2Y alloy with good mechanical properties and corrosion resistance was selected as the basic material, and Nd and Zn elements were added to refine the alloy stents. After the microstructure of the stent was extruded, the surface modification of the stent was completed and the comprehensive properties of the alloy were improved. The new magnesium alloy for the stent was obtained and the stent surface was modified. The metallographic microstructure, scanning electron microscopy and radiological analysis were used to study the microstructure and mechanical properties of the prepared stents. The mechanical properties of the stents were investigated by hardness and tensile tests.RESULTS AND CONCLUSION: (1) Metallographic microstructure results showed that: when Y elements were not added, the second phase of the magnesium alloy was rod-shaped, and there were a few granules embedded in the matrix. After addition of 0.5% Y elements, in the second phase of the magnesium alloy stent, the shafts were significantly reduced in number, and granules were increased in number and evenly distributed in the body. After the addition of 1% Y,the second phase number increased, a large number of dendrites were visible in the grains, and discontinuous rods existed in the second phase. After the addition of 1.5% Y, the second phase was rod-shaped, with mixture of large and local dendrites in the alloy. (2) X-ray diffraction test results: Mn-Zn-0.5Nd alloy and Mn-Zn-1.0Nd alloy contained the same phases (Mg4Zn7 and (Nd, Y) 2Zn17 phase). When the concentration of Nd increased to 1%, the new MgZn2 phase appeared in the alloy. (3) SEM & EDS test results of modified magnesium alloy showed that after magnesium alloy modification, the second phase contained Zn, Nd and Y elements, and their contents were very close. EDS analysis showed that after the addition of Zr elements, the level of Zn elements in the lamellar second phase decreased significantly, and the level of Nd and Y elements increased, indicating a more stable performance. (4) Micro-hardness test results showed that with the increasing of the content of magnesium alloy, the alloy microhardness increased. (5)Tensile test results showed that the tensile strength and yield strength of the Mg-Zn-Y-0.5Nd-Zr stent were significantly higher than those of Mg-Zn-Y-0.5Nd, Mg-Zn-Y-1.0Nd,Mg-Zn-Y-1.0Nd-Zr stents (P < 0.05); and the elongation at break of Mg-Zn-Y-0.5Nd-Zr and Mg-Zn-Y-1.0Nd-Zr stents was significantly higher than that of Mg-Zn-Y-1.0Nd and Mg-Zn-Y-0.5Nd stents (P < 0.05). To conclude, with Mg-2Zn-0.2Y as core materials, the material modification could be completed by the addition of Nd and Zn elements, and the surface modification could be implemented by extruding and refining the stent microstructure. The modified material has excellent properties.
7.Transcription factor Yin-Yang1 and tumor
Yun TANG ; Xueli LI ; Xuezhu XU
Journal of International Oncology 2012;39(2):89-92
Yin-Yang1 (YY1),as a ubiquitous nuclear transcription factor with double transcriptional activity in eukaryotic cells,regulates many genes transcription and plays an important role in the cellule biological processes.Overexpression of YY1 is found in several tumor types recently,and may play a role in tumor development and progression by regulating oncogenes,tumor suppressor genes,angiogenesis related factors,as well as apoptosis.YY1 may become a new kind of tumor markers,is conducive to estimate the prognosis of patients with tumor and gain important breakthrough in cancer targeted therapy.

9.Gene expression of nucleosome assembly protein-1 in specific brain regions of MPTP-treated mice and beta-amyloid-treated rats
Lei XU ; Lixia LU ; Huiyun LI ; Jingsong YAO ; Xueli LI
Chinese Journal of Geriatrics 2000;0(06):-
Objective To investigate the expression of apoptosis-related neuclosome assembly protein-1(NAP-1) gene in related brain region of 1-methyl-4-phenyl-1,2,3,6-tetrahydropyridine(MPTP) treated mice and beta-amyloid treated rats. Methods The animal models with central nervous system degeneration were established by consecutive administration of MPTP to C57BL mice and injection of beta-amyloid to brain ventricular of SD rats. The RNA in striatum and substantia nigra of mice and the RNA in cortex and hippocampus of rats were extracted. The levels of NAP-1 mRNA in these samples were estimated by RT-PCR. Results For mice, the expression of NAP-1 were decreased after MPTP treatment in substantia nigra, while its expression showed no significant change in striatum. In contrast, no effect on NAP-1 gene expression by beta-amyloid injection can be detected in cortex and hippocampus of rats. Conclusions The apoptosis of dopaminergic neurons in nigrostriatal pathway after MPTP treatment may be related to the expression of NAP-1 gene. But the mechanism of neurodegeneration after beta-amyloid injection in rats may be different.
10.Epidemiology investigation of nonalcoholic fatty liver disease in Yichang professional crowd and its correlation with the metabolic syndrome
Chunhua LUO ; Guojing LI ; Jun ZHOU ; Zhenglian JING ; Xueli LI
Chongqing Medicine 2016;(3):390-392
Objective To study the prevalence rate of nonalc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D)and its correlation with the metabolic syndrome among professional crowd in Yichang city ,and analyze the characteristic of prevalence of NAFLD .Methods Physical check‐up and liver ultrasonography were done and fasting blood GLU ,TG ,HDL‐C ,UA ,CRP were measured for sampling survey professional people in Yichang city .We sampled 6 450 people in 15 company ,including 3 284 men ,3 166 women(20 to 70 years old) ,the results were analyzed .Results The NAFLD prevalence rate of Yichang professional crowd was 21 .71% ,28 .68% in male and 14 .47% in female respectively(P<0 .01) .The prevalence rate in male was higher than that of female before 60 years old . NAFLD prevalence rate in women showed a trend of increasing along with the age growth ,the incidence rate come up to 31 .31%when women were over 60 years old .The highest prevalence rate of MS related components in NAFLD group were obesity (69 .98% )、high blood TG level(61 .10% ) .Conclusion Male before 60 years old and female over 60 years old of Yichang profes‐sional crowd belong to NAFLD high‐risk groups ,the group should be focused on as regular monitoring ,prevention and interven‐tion .NAFLD prevalence rate significantly increased in people with MS .The most important factors of suffering from NAFLD are o‐besity ,high blood TG level .
